Meatloaf and eggs
My mom used to make her meatloaf this same way---adding hardboiled eggs in the center of the meatloaf and baking it this way. I loved how the meatloaf looked when you sliced it down the middle...with a cross section of egg peeking out. So yesterday I too made a meatloaf with hardboiled eggs cooked in it. The recipe comes from the mostly-Paleo site, Everyday Maven dot com.
One recommendation I would make is to not use lean ground beef for your meatloaf and stick with the usual 80% lean, 20% fat. I mistakenly used a leaner beef and thus, the meatloaf was a tad dry. Leaving the fat in there will only add to its juiciness and flavor.
Other than that, I loved this meatloaf; super tasty and hearty!
